Blue Owl Stock Surges on Q1 Earnings Beat

Key Highlights of Blue Owl's Q1 Results

Blue Owl Capital shares experienced a 6% increase in premarket trading following the release of its first-quarter financial results. The alternative asset manager reported figures that surpassed analyst consensus estimates, signaling strong operational performance.

Financial Overview and Market Context

The company announced adjusted distributable earnings of 19 cents per share, slightly above the 18 cents forecasted by Wall Street. Fee-related earnings per share also grew to 25 cents, an increase from 22 cents in the same quarter last year.

A significant driver of this performance was a 15% year-over-year expansion in assets under management, which reached $314.9 billion. However, despite the positive quarterly report, the stock has seen a substantial 40.6% decline year-to-date.

Impact on Investors and Market Sentiment

The immediate market reaction to the earnings beat was positive, reflected in the premarket stock surge. This suggests renewed investor confidence in the company's core business fundamentals. The strong AUM growth indicates sustained client trust and capital inflow.

Summary

While Blue Owl's strong first-quarter performance has provided a short-term boost to its stock, the significant year-to-date decline remains a key consideration for investors. Future performance will likely depend on the company's ability to maintain its growth trajectory in a challenging market environment.
